Cornell men’s hockey to compete in NCAA tournament

ITHACA, NY (607NewsNow) — The Big Red men’s hockey season will continue.

Cornell will play the University of Denver in the NCAA tournament. The game takes place Friday in Colorado at 6 p.m. Eastern.

Cornell hasn’t played Denver since March 2024. The Pioneers won that matchup 2-1.

This past Friday, Cornell fell to Princeton 3-2 in the ECAC semifinals. Despite the loss, Cornell was selected to compete in the NCAA tournament.
